BMW DONATES RMB 1 MILLION TO EARTHQUAKE DISASTER RELIEF IN SICHUAN PROVINCE
05/15/2008

Appeal for all BMW dealers and customers to join forces to combat the disaster
Munich/Beijing. The powerful earthquake which hit Sichuan Province with a magnitude of 7.8 caused severe damage in the area and BMW China and BMW Brilliance have responded with prompt action. BMW donated RMB 1,000,000 to the Red Cross Society of China for the eathquake disaster relief and assigned 3 units of BMW X3 for the rescue team to help disaster relief. At the same time, BMW appealed to all BMW dealers and customers to provide their support as much as possible to join forces in times of hardship. BMW staff have also started to donate funds and the donations will be sent to the earthquake-hit area.

The Red Cross Society of China commented, "The disaster relief needs efforts from all walks of life and social resources home and abroad. Guided under the Red Cross Spirit of 'Humanity, Charity, and Dedication', BMW took action immediately. This initiation showing BMW's care and responsibility is worthy of commendation and recommendation. We dedicate our sincere thanks to BMW."

Mr. Alfred Rupp, President and CEO of BMW Brilliance Automotive Ltd., said, "BMW has a long-term commitment to China and integrates to the Chinese social development. It is our duty, without hesitation, to help people in the disaster-afflicted area get through the difficulties. We will continue the internal donating activity, expressing our care to the victims to fulfil our social responsibility as a corporate citizen."

As a matter of fact, taking active participation in the public welfare has always been one of BMW's corporate objectives. Earlier this year, BMW took the lead among auto manufacturers to donate 1 million RMB to the China Charity Federation for disaster relief in snow-stricken area in southern China.
In addition, BMW China and BMW Brilliance have called on the authorized dealers and BMW customers nationwide to participate in the relief campaign to lend a helping hand to the people in disaster area. Up to now, Beijing Yanbao Group, a BMW authorized dealer in Beijing has donated 450,000 RMB. Chongqing Baosheng donated 50,000 RMB, and will contribute 1,000 RMB for each car sold from now to the end of this month. Also, Chengdu Dajin and Chengdu Bow Yue, BMW dealers in Chengdu, nearest to the disaster area have organized all the staff members to donate blood to the injured. More dealers and customers will join BMW in the relief efforts to combat the disaster together.



In the tire tracks of a legend: BMW 328 at the 2008 Mille Miglia
05/14/2008

Munich/Brescia. It was 70 years ago that BMW first entered its 328 model in the Mille Miglia. For this year's anniversary appearance, BMW will be following the historic example by deploying four of these legendary roadsters in the event. Joining them will be the BMW 328 Berlin-Rom racing variant from 1941 as well as a BMW 327 Convertible and a 327/28 Coup?®. With nine private teams entering, a total of 16 BMW cars will be lining up in Brescia for the start of the 2008 Mille Miglia.

For the first time this year, BMW's heritage division will be debuting under its new designation BMW Classic. "Taking part in such a tradition-rich event with our new name is very special for us," said the Director of BMW Classic, Karl Baumer. "And the fact that we will be on the road exactly 70 years after the first BMW 328 lends extra appeal to the race," he added. But the achievements of those historic forerunners are unlikely to be surpassed: 70 years ago the teams in their BMW 328s swept up the first four places in the 2000 cc class and majestically claimed the team trophy in the regularity race.

"Landing on Planet Life Ball" - Life Ball MINI 2008 by Agent Provocateur prepares to land in Vienna. First public appearance on 17 May on the red carpet outside Vienna's City Hall.
05/14/2008

Munich / Vienna. "Landing on planet Life Ball" - on the evening of 17 May 2008, Life Ball will be inviting guests on a trip through time in which bridges will be built to supposedly alien cultural universes which actually exist next to each other and the infinite opportunities of social coexistence energetically highlighted. In line with these concepts, the Agent Provocateur lingerie label has designed the Life Ball MINI 2008. The new MINI Cooper Clubman has been selected as the basis for this exclusive, unique design. Agent Provocateur, founded by Serena Rees and her husband Joseph Corre, son of fashion creator Vivienne Westwood, is famous for its wickedly burlesque collections.

295670720_h4ctX-M.jpg



"It has been a lot of fun to lend our unique brand identity to the MINI Clubman. The new shape is reminiscent of the old English Mini police van that we were immediately inspired to create an Agent Provocateur styled interior that you really would want to get banged up in! A classic yet suped up exterior in Agent Provocateur signature pink and black colours complete with pink flashing light and inside.....the most seductive prison cell with hand to wall cuffs and blacked out windows and iron bars!

Ever mindful that the long arm of the law needs ample space when interrogating a captive prisoner, we have supplied our Agent Provocateur police car with fully reclining rear seats and ankle cuffs for forensic investigation. With saddle stitched leather seat and bespoke compartments for the note pad and pen, the Agent Provocateur MINI police van is the perfect patrol car for checking the offending publics undercover credentials wouldn't you say"says Joseph Corre.

295671661_GggJY-M.jpg



At the first public appearance of the MINI by Agent Provocateur, Joseph Corre, the create of the unique design, will be behind the steering wheel himself - along with a "breath-taking" passenger, of course - and will drive the MINI across the red carpet outside Vienna's City Hall for the start of the Life Ball Opening Show.

After the Life Ball, the unique MINI will be auctioned worldwide on eBay (www.ebay.at) from 5-15 June. The proceeds will be donated to Life Ball, as they are every years. So far, the "Life Ball MINIs" - transformed by such famous fashion icons as Missoni, Ferr?® and Versace - have raised a total of Ôé¼ 260,000.-.
